WebThe Coexistence of Good and Evil. The most important theme of To Kill a Mockingbird is the book’s exploration of the moral nature of human beings—that is, whether people are essentially good or essentially evil. The novel approaches this question by dramatizing Scout and Jem’s transition from a perspective of childhood innocence, in which ... WebMorality and Ethics (Click the themes infographic to download.) Atticus thinks that everyone deserves a fair trial. Maycomb thinks that only white men do. Scout thinks that her father is right. Maycomb thinks that her father is wrong. So, who's more moral—the community standard, or the individual conscience?
